Yuichi Kamikubo is a scholar working on Hematology, Cancer Research and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Yuichi Kamikubo has authored 48 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 36 papers in Hematology, 20 papers in Cancer Research and 11 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. Recurrent topics in Yuichi Kamikubo’s work include Blood Coagulation and Thrombosis Mechanisms (32 papers), Protease and Inhibitor Mechanisms (20 papers) and Cell Adhesion Molecules Research (9 papers). Yuichi Kamikubo is often cited by papers focused on Blood Coagulation and Thrombosis Mechanisms (32 papers), Protease and Inhibitor Mechanisms (20 papers) and Cell Adhesion Molecules Research (9 papers). Yuichi Kamikubo coll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and Denmark. Yuichi Kamikubo's co-authors include David J. Loskutoff, Hisao Kato, Yujiro Asada, Jaap G. Neels, Bernard Degryse, Kinta Hatakeyama, Akinobu Sumiyoshi, Yuichiro Sato, Kousuke Marutsuka and Kathleen Aertgeerts and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Circulation and Blood.
